HOUSTON -- Three members of the Expedition 31 crew undocked from the International Space Station and returned safely to Earth Sunday, July 1, wrapping up a mission that lasted six-and-a-half months.

Russian Commander Oleg Kononenko, NASA Flight Engineer Don Pettit and European Space Agency Flight Engineer Andre Kuipers landed their Soyuz TMA-03M spacecraft in Kazakhstan at 3:14 a.m. CDT (2:14 p.m. local time) after undocking from the space station's Rassvet module at 11:47 p.m. June 30. The trio, which arrived at the station Dec. 23, 2011, spent a total of 193 days in space, 191 of which were aboard the station.

During their expedition, the crew supported more than 200 scientific investigations involving more than 400 researchers around the world. The studies ranged from integrated investigations of the human cardiovascular and immune systems to fluid, flame and robotic research.

Before leaving the station, Kononenko handed over command of Expedition 32 to the Russian Federal Space Agency's Gennady Padalka, who remains aboard the station with NASA astronaut Joe Acaba and Russian cosmonaut Sergei Revin. NASA astronaut Sunita Williams, Russian cosmonaut Yuri Malenchenko and Japan Aerospace Exploration Agency astronaut Akihiko Hoshide will join them July 17. Williams, Malenchenko and Hoshide are scheduled to launch July 14 from the Baikonur Cosmodrome in Kazakhstan.

On June 25, Pettit celebrated achieving one cumulative year in space, combining his time in orbit on Expedition 6, Expedition 30/31 and the STS-126 space shuttle Endeavour flight to the station in November 2008. Pettit now has 370 days in space, placing him fourth among U.S. space fliers for the longest time in space.

During Expedition 31, Pettit also used household objects aboard the station to perform a variety of unusual physics experiments for the video series "Science Off the Sphere." Through these demonstrations, Pettit showed more than a million Internet viewers how space affects scientific principles.

Picture Perfect Landing


The Soyuz TMA-03M spacecraft is seen as it lands with Expedition 31 Commander Oleg Kononenko of Russia and Flight Engineers Don Pettit of NASA and Andre Kuipers of the European Space Agency in a remote area near the town of Zhezkazgan, Kazakhstan, on Sunday, July 1, 2012.

Pettit, Kononenko and Kuipers returned from more than six months onboard the International Space Station where they served as members of the Expedition 30 and 31 crews.

WASHINGTON – Elementary, middle and high school students will have the opportunity to speak with Expedition 31 flight engineers Don Pettit, Joseph Acaba and André Kuipers aboard the International Space Station at 10:35 a.m. EDT, Tuesday, June 26.

The event will take place at Philadelphia University in Philadelphia. Media representatives are invited to attend. It will be broadcast live on NASA Television and include video of the space station residents.

The event will be hosted by Destination Imagination, a non-profit organization that provides education programs for students to learn and experience creativity, teamwork and problem solving.

To attend the event, reporters must contact Michelle Griffith at 813-597-8187 or michelle@clearviewcom.com. Philadelphia University is located at 4201 Henry Avenue.

Pettit, Kuipers, and Russian cosmonaut Oleg Konenenko arrived at the space station on Dec. 23, 2011. Acaba and Russian cosmonauts Gennady Padalka and Sergei Revin completed the six-person crew on May 17.

This in-flight education downlink is one in a series with educational organizations in the United States and abroad to improve science, technology, engineering and mathematics (STEM) teaching and learning. It is an integral component of NASA's Teaching From Space education program, which promotes learning opportunities and builds partnerships with the education community using the unique environment of space and NASA's human spaceflight program.

Inside the Dragon (Capsule)


This image of the inside of the Dragon module was taken by European Space Agency astronaut Andre Kuipers.

The SpaceX Falcon 9 and its Dragon spacecraft launched on Tuesday, May 22, at 3:44 a.m. EDT.

This mission is a demonstration flight by Space Exploration Technologies, or SpaceX, as part of its contract with NASA to have private companies launch cargo safely to the International Space Station.

HOUSTON -- The International Space Station's Expedition 31 crew grappled and attached SpaceX's Dragon capsule to the space station Friday. This is the first time a commercial company has accomplished this type of space operation.

"Today marks another critical step in the future of American spaceflight," NASA Administrator Charles Bolden said. "Now that a U.S. company has proven its ability to resupply the space station, it opens a new frontier for commercial opportunities in space -- and new job creation opportunities right here in the U.S. By handing off space station transportation to the private sector, NASA is freed up to carry out the really hard work of sending astronauts farther into the solar system than ever before. The Obama Administration has set us on an ambitious path forward and the NASA and SpaceX teams are proving they are up to the task."

Following a series of system tests and a successful fly-under of the space station Thursday, the Dragon capsule was cleared by NASA to approach the station Friday. Dragon then performed a series of intricate test maneuvers as it approached the orbiting laboratory. These maneuvers were required to demonstrate the maneuvering and abort capability of Dragon prior to approaching and moving into a 65-foot (20-meter) "berthing box" where it was grappled by NASA astronaut Don Pettit using the station's robotic arm at 9:56 a.m. EDT.

European Space Agency astronaut Andre Kuipers installed the capsule on the bottom of the station's Harmony node at 11:52 a.m. NASA astronaut Joe Acaba completed berthing operations by bolting the Dragon to Harmony at 12:02 p.m.

"Congratulations to the SpaceX and NASA teams," said William Gerstenmaier, associate administrator for NASA's Human Exploration and Operations Mission Directorate at the agency's headquarters in Washington. "There is no limit to what can be accomplished with hard work and preparation. This activity will help the space station reach its full research potential and open up space-based research to a larger group of researchers. There is still critical work left in this test flight. Dragon-attached operations and cargo return are challenging and yet to be accomplished."

The Dragon capsule lifted off Tuesday from the Cape Canaveral Air Force Station in Florida aboard a SpaceX Falcon 9 rocket. The demonstration mission is the second under NASA's Commercial Orbital Transportation Services program, which provides investments intended to lead to regular resupply missions to the space station and stimulate the commercial space industry in America.

"The investments made by the United States to stimulate the commercial space industry are paying off," said Philip McAlister, director for Commercial Spaceflight Development at NASA Headquarters. "SpaceX achieved what until now was only possible by a few governments, and the company did it with relatively modest funding from the government.

The Dragon capsule is delivering 1,014 pounds of supplies to the station, which includes non-critical experiments, food, clothing and technology. Crew members will open the hatch to the capsule Saturday and unload the cargo during a four-day period. Dragon then will be loaded with 1,367 pounds of hardware and cargo no longer needed aboard the station in preparation for the spacecraft's return to Earth. Dragon and station hatches will be closed on May 30.

On May 31, the Expedition 31 crew members will detach Dragon from Harmony, maneuver it to a 33-foot release point and un-grapple the capsule. Dragon will deorbit approximately four hours after leaving the station, taking about 30 minutes to re-enter Earth's atmosphere and landing in the Pacific Ocean about 250 miles west of southern California.
